Protein lactylation is a post-translational modification associated with glycolysis. Although recent evidence indicates that protein lactylation is involved in epigenetic gene regulation, its pathophysiological significance remains unclear, particularly in neoplasms. Herein, we investigated the potential involvement of protein lactylation in the molecular mechanisms underlying benign and malignant pancreatic epithelial tumors, as well as its role in the response of pancreatic cancer (PC) cells to gemcitabine. Increased lactylation was observed in the nuclei of intraductal papillary mucinous adenoma, non-invasive intraductal papillary mucinous carcinoma, and invasive carcinoma, in parallel to the upregulation of hypoxia-inducible factor-1α. This observation indicated that a hypoxia-associated increase in nuclear protein lactylation could be a biochemical hallmark in pancreatic epithelial tumors. The standard PC chemotherapy drug gemcitabine suppressed histone lactylation in vitro, suggesting that histone lactylation might be relevant to its mechanism of action. Taken together, our findings suggest that protein lactylation may be involved in the development of pancreatic epithelial tumors and could represent a potential therapeutic target for PC.

BACKGROUND & AIMS: Despite previously reported treatment strategies for nonfunctioning small (≤20 mm) pancreatic neuroendocrine neoplasms (pNENs), uncertainties persist. We aimed to evaluate the surgically resected cases of nonfunctioning small pNENs (NF-spNENs) in a large Japanese cohort to elucidate an optimal treatment strategy for NF-spNENs. METHODS: In this Japanese multicenter study, data were retrospectively collected from patients who underwent pancreatectomy between January 1996 and December 2019, were pathologically diagnosed with pNEN, and were treated according to the World Health Organization 2019 classification. Overall, 1490 patients met the eligibility criteria, and 1014 were included in the analysis cohort. RESULTS: In the analysis cohort, 606 patients (59.8%) had NF-spNENs, with 82% classified as grade 1 (NET-G1) and 18% as grade 2 (NET-G2) or higher. The incidence of lymph node metastasis (N1) by grade was significantly higher in NET-G2 (G1: 3.1% vs G2: 15.0%). Independent factors contributing to N1 were NET-G2 or higher and tumor diameter ≥15 mm. The predictive ability of tumor size for N1 was high. Independent factors contributing to recurrence included multiple lesions, NET-G2 or higher, tumor diameter ≥15 mm, and N1. However, the independent factor contributing to survival was tumor grade (NET-G2 or higher). The appropriate timing for surgical resection of NET-G1 and NET-G2 or higher was when tumors were >20 and >10 mm, respectively. For neoplasms with unknown preoperative grades, tumor size >15 mm was considered appropriate. CONCLUSIONS: NF-spNENs are heterogeneous with varying levels of malignancy. Therefore, treatment strategies based on tumor size alone can be unreliable; personalized treatment strategies that consider tumor grading are preferable.

BACKGROUND/OBJECTIVES: The association between autoimmune pancreatitis (AIP) and pancreatic cancer (PC) remains controversial. This study aimed to clarify the long-term prognosis and risk of malignancies in AIP patients in Japan. METHODS: We conducted a multicenter retrospective cohort study on 1364 patients with type 1 AIP from 20 institutions in Japan. We calculated the standardized incidence ratio (SIR) for malignancies compared to that in the general population. We analyzed factors associated with overall survival, pancreatic exocrine insufficiency, diabetes mellitus, and osteoporosis. RESULTS: The SIR for all malignancies was increased (1.21 [95 % confidence interval: 1.05-1.41]) in patients with AIP. Among all malignancies, the SIR was highest for PC (3.22 [1.99-5.13]) and increased within 2 years and after 5 years of AIP diagnosis. Steroid use for ≥6 months and ≥50 months increased the risk of subsequent development of diabetes mellitus and osteoporosis, respectively. Age ≥65 years at AIP diagnosis (hazard ratio [HR] = 3.73) and the development of malignancies (HR = 2.63), including PC (HR = 7.81), were associated with a poor prognosis, whereas maintenance steroid therapy was associated with a better prognosis (HR = 0.35) in the multivariate analysis. Maintenance steroid therapy was associated with a better prognosis even after propensity score matching for age and sex. CONCLUSIONS: Patients with AIP are at increased risk of developing malignancy, especially PC. PC is a critical prognostic factor for patients with AIP. Although maintenance steroid therapy negatively impacts diabetes mellitus and osteoporosis, it is associated with decreased cancer risk and improved overall survival.

BACKGROUND: Microsatellite instability high (MSI-H) and tumor mutational burden high (TMB-high) pancreatic cancer are rare, and information is lacking. Based on the C-CAT database, we analyzed the clinical and genomic characteristics of patients with these subtypes. METHODS: We retrospectively reviewed data on 2206 patients with unresectable pancreatic adenocarcinoma enrolled in C-CAT between July 2019 and January 2022. The clinical features, proportion of genomic variants classified as oncogenic/pathogenic in C-CAT, overall response rate (ORR), disease control rate (DCR), and time to treatment failure (TTF) of chemotherapy as first-line treatment were evaluated. RESULTS: Numbers of patients with MSI-H and TMB-high were 7 (0.3%) and 39 (1.8%), respectively. All MSI-H patients were TMB-high. MSI-H and TMB-high patients harbored more mismatch repair genes, such as MSH2, homologous recombination-related genes, such as ATR and BRCA2, and other genes including BRAF, KMT2D, and SMARCA4. None of the 6 MSI-H patients who received chemotherapy achieved a clinical response, including 4 patients treated with gemcitabine plus nab-paclitaxel (GnP) therapy, whose DCR was significantly lower than that of microsatellite stable (MSS) patients (0 vs. 67.0%, respectively, p = 0.01). Among the TMB-high and TMB-low groups, no significant differences were shown in ORR, DCR (17.1 vs. 23.1% and 57.1 vs. 63.1%, respectively), or median TTF (25.9 vs. 28.0 weeks, respectively) of overall first-line chemotherapy. CONCLUSIONS: MSI-H and TMB-high pancreatic cancers showed some distinct genomic and clinical features from our real-world data. These results suggest the importance of adapting optimal treatment strategies according to the genomic alterations.

Introduction: Although the efficacy of 5-aminosalicylic acid (ASA) suppositories for ulcerative colitis (UC) has been reported in many studies, many studies have also described poor adherence to 5-ASA suppository regimens. We aimed to identify the clinical background factors that influence adherence to 5-ASA suppositories to improve adherence and efficacy of the treatment. Methods: We conducted a retrospective cohort study of 61 patients with active UC who were using 5-ASA suppositories. All patients underwent endoscopy and rectal biopsy for histological diagnosis prior to 5-ASA suppository treatment. The efficacy of 5-ASA suppository treatment was compared in relation to clinical background factors (sex, age, disease duration, disease type, clinical activity, Ulcerative Colitis Endoscopic Index of Severity, histological activity, serum C-reactive protein level, concomitant use of immunomodulators, history of steroid use, and dose of oral 5-ASA). Results: The efficacy of 5-ASA suppositories was significantly related to low Lichtiger Colitis Activity Index (LCAI) scores and proctitis type prior to its use. In terms of sex, females tended to show higher efficacy. Multivariate logistic regression analysis using these three factors showed high predictive value for the efficacy of 5-ASA suppositories (AUC, 0.788; sensitivity, 87.2%; and specificity, 63.7%). Conclusion: This study is the first to extract clinical background factors for predicting the efficacy of 5-ASA suppositories. The use of 5-ASA suppositories in patients who are expected to show efficacy will be effective in improving patient co-operation.

Streptozotocin (STZ), an anti-cancer drug that is primarily used to treat neuroendocrine tumors (NETs) in clinical settings, is incorporated into pancreatic ß-cells or proximal tubular epithelial cells through the glucose transporter, GLUT2. However, its cytotoxic effects on kidney cells have been underestimated and the underlying mechanisms remain unclear. We herein demonstrated that DNA damage and subsequent p53 signaling were responsible for the development of STZ-induced tubular epithelial injury. We detected tubular epithelial DNA damage in NET patients treated with STZ. Unbiased transcriptomics of STZ-treated tubular epithelial cells in vitro showed the activation of the p53 signaling pathway. STZ induced DNA damage and activated p53 signaling in vivo in a dose-dependent manner, resulting in reduced membrane transporters. The pharmacological inhibition of p53 and sodium-glucose transporter 2 (SGLT2) mitigated STZ-induced epithelial injury. However, the cytotoxic effects of STZ on pancreatic ß-cells were preserved in SGLT2 inhibitor-treated mice. The present results demonstrate the proximal tubular-specific cytotoxicity of STZ and the underlying mechanisms in vivo. Since the cytotoxic effects of STZ against ß-cells were not impaired by dapagliflozin, pretreatment with an SGLT2 inhibitor has potential as a preventative remedy for kidney injury in NET patients treated with STZ.

BACKGROUND: Special subtypes of pancreatic cancer, such as acinar cell carcinoma (ACC), adenosquamous carcinoma (ASC), and anaplastic carcinoma of the pancreas (ACP), are rare, and so data on them are limited. Using the C-CAT database, we analyzed clinical and genomic characteristics of patients with these and evaluated differences on comparison with pancreatic ductal adenocarcinoma (PDAC) patients. METHODS: We retrospectively reviewed data on 2691 patients with unresectable pancreatic cancer: ACC, ASC, ACP, and PDAC, entered into C-CAT from June 2019 to December 2021. The clinical features, MSI/TMB status, genomic alterations, overall response rate (ORR), disease control rate (DCR), and time to treatment failure (TTF) on receiving FOLFIRINOX (FFX) or GEM + nab-PTX (GnP) therapy as first-line treatment were evaluated. RESULTS: Numbers of patients with ACC, ASC, ACP, and PDAC were 44 (1.6%), 54 (2.0%), 25 (0.9%), and 2,568 (95.4%), respectively. KRAS and TP53 mutations were prevalent in ASC, ACP, and PDAC (90.7/85.2, 76.0/68.0, and 85.1/69.1%, respectively), while their rates were both significantly lower in ACC (13.6/15.9%, respectively). Conversely, the rate of homologous recombination-related (HRR) genes, including ATM and BRCA1/2, was significantly higher in ACC (11.4/15.9%) than PDAC (2.5/3.7%). In ASC and ACP, no significant differences in ORR, DCR, or TTF between FFX and GnP were noted, while ACC patients showed a trend toward higher ORR with FFX than GnP (61.5 vs. 23.5%, p = 0.06) and significantly more favorable TTF (median 42.3 vs. 21.0 weeks, respectively, p = 0.004). CONCLUSIONS: ACC clearly harbors different genomics compared with PDAC, possibly accounting for differences in treatment efficacy.

PURPOSE: Anamorelin, a ghrelin receptor agonist, has recently been approved for gastric, pancreatic, and colorectal cancer patients with cachexia in Japan. However, only few studies have investigated the predictors of response to anamorelin in clinical settings. Thus, our study aimed to investigate the predictors of the response, in addition to its efficacy and safety. METHODS: The clinical outcomes of 20 patients were evaluated during administration. They were divided into two groups based on lean body mass, responders and non-responders, and their clinical characteristics were compared. RESULTS: The mean ± standard error (SE) variations at 12 weeks in lean body mass and handgrip strength were 2.63 ± 0.79 kg and - 1.53 ± 1.20 kg, respectively. The mean ± SE variations at 8 weeks in fasting blood glucose and hemoglobin A1c were 32.88 ± 13.77 mg/dL and 0.90 ± 0.18%, respectively. Total protein, albumin, transferrin, and prognostic nutritional index at baseline were significantly higher in responders (n = 8) than in non-responders (n = 12), whereas the neutrophil/lymphocyte and C-reactive protein/albumin ratios at baseline were significantly higher in non-responders than in responders. CONCLUSION: The study confirmed the efficacy and safety of anamorelin and identified nutritional or systemic inflammatory markers as predictors of anamorelin response in advanced gastrointestinal cancer patients.

BACKGROUND AND AIMS: Mucosal addressin cell adhesion molecule 1 [MAdCAM-1] is upregulated in the vascular endothelium of the colonic mucosa in ulcerative colitis [UC]. Although the association between MAdCAM-1 expression and mucosal inflammation has been discussed, the association with the clinical course of UC patients has not been reported. In this study we investigated not only the association between mucosal MAdCAM-1 expression and mucosal inflammation, but also its association with subsequent relapse in UC patients with clinical remission. METHODS: Eighty UC patients in remission who visited Kyoto Prefectural University of Medicine for follow-up for 2 years were included. Biopsy samples were collected during colonoscopy, and transcriptional expression levels of UC-related cytokines and MAdCAM-1 were quantified using real-time polymerase chain reaction. MAdCAM-1 mRNA expression and protein expression by immunohistochemistry were compared in patients who subsequently relapsed and those who remained in remission and were examined in relation to endoscopic findings, histological activity and cytokine expression. RESULTS: MAdCAM-1 expression was correlated with endoscopic severity, and significantly elevated in histologically active mucosa than inactive mucosa. Furthermore, MAdCAM-1 expression levels were closely correlated with those of several cytokines. MAdCAM-1 mRNA and protein expression were significantly higher in the relapse group than in the remission group, indicating that MAdCAM-1 expression in the mucosa is already elevated in UC patients in clinical remission who subsequently relapse. CONCLUSIONS: MAdCAM-1 expression in the colonic mucosa of UC patients is related to mucosal inflammation and subsequent relapse; it may serve as a marker for both relapse and therapeutic effectiveness in UC.

Small intestinal lipomas are rare, but may cause obscure gastrointestinal bleeding. The endoscopic unroofing technique excises only the upper third of the lipoma and allows both histological confirmation and complete treatment with minimal risk of perforation. We present a rare case of obscure gastrointestinal bleeding caused by a jejunal lipoma. A 75-year-old man on antiplatelet therapy presented to our department with melena and anemia. Computed tomography revealed he had a 45-mm jejunal submucosal tumor with fat attenuation. Endoscopic resection using an endoscopic unroofing technique with double balloon enteroscopy was successfully performed. The tumor was confirmed to be a lipoma.

BACKGROUND: Endoscopic retrograde cholangiopancreatography (ERCP) is a popular technique; however, post-ERCP pancreatitis (PEP) remains a major adverse event. The administration of rectal nonsteroidal anti-inflammatory drugs (NSAIDs) is reportedly effective in preventing PEP. However, the recommended dose varies and the efficacy of low-dose rectal NSAIDs remains unclear. Therefore, we decided to investigate the effectiveness of low-dose rectal diclofenac on PEP prevention, using propensity score matching. METHODS: This single-center retrospective study included 401 patients who underwent ERCP between July 2015 and March 2020. After December 2016, we administered rectal diclofenac within 30 min before the ERCP procedure as widely as possible. Patients were divided into those who did (diclofenac group) and did not (control group) receive rectal diclofenac. Patients weighing ≥ 50 kg were administered a 50 mg dose, while those weighing < 50 kg were administered a 25 mg dose. The incidence and severity of PEP in the two groups were assessed by propensity score matching analysis. RESULTS: Among 401 patients undergoing ERCP, 367 fulfilled the inclusion criteria. Overall, 187 patients received rectal diclofenac (diclofenac group) and 180 did not (control group). After propensity score matching, 105 pairs were selected for evaluation. Overall, seven (6.7%) patients in the diclofenac group and 10 (9.5%) in the control group developed PEP (P = 0.45). Moderate or severe PEP occurred in four (3.8%) patients in the diclofenac group and six (5.7%) in the control group (P = 0.52). CONCLUSIONS: The administration of low-dose rectal diclofenac could not reduce the incidence and severity of PEP.

A solid pseudopapillary neoplasm (SPN) of the pancreas is a rare neoplasm that mainly occurs in young women. We herein report the case of spontaneous regression in SPN of the pancreas. A 48-years-old female was found to have a mass in the head of the pancreas on examination for her back pain and referred to our hospital in 20XX. Laboratory data showed no abnormalities in serum levels of pancreatic enzymes and tumor markers. A contrast CT scan of upper abdomen showed a slightly enhanced lesion (23 × 19 mm in diameter) without cystic component or fibrous capsule in the head of the pancreas. An MRI scan showed the mass as low-intensity in T1-WI and high-intensity in T2-WI. She admitted to our hospital for further examination of a pancreatic mass by EUS-FNA in 20XX + 4. EUS showed a slightly hypoechoic mass (30 × 19 mm in diameter) compared with the neighboring normal pancreas. Tumor margin was relatively clear and the internal echo image was homogenous. Histological findings revealed a solid and pseudopapillary proliferation of eosinophilic polygonal cells with oval nuclei. The tumor cells were positive for vimentin and CD10 in the cytoplasm and ß-catenin in the nuclei, which led to the diagnosis of SPN. We recommended this patient to undergo surgical resection, however, the patient chose follow-up examinations. Follow-up study after 1 year using MRI scan showed spontaneous regression, which was coincided with her menopause. These findings suggest that the natural regression of SPN may occur and female sex hormone changes may regulate the growth of SPN.

Primary pancreatic lymphoma is a rare pancreatic malignancy, reportedly accounting for only 0.2-0.7% of all primary pancreatic tumors. Primary pancreatic lymphoma is often difficult to distinguish from other diseases, such as acute pancreatitis. We herein report the autopsy of a patient with primary pancreatic lymphoma with imaging findings resembling those of severe acute pancreatitis, with a focus on the gross and histological features.

Mesalamine is a key drug in the treatment of ulcerative colitis (UC) for both induction and maintenance therapy. On the other hand, it is known that there are some cases of mesalamine intolerance that are difficult to distinguish from symptoms due to aggravation of UC. The aim of this study is to investigate the clinical characteristic of mesalamine intolerance in UC. A retrospective, observational study was conducted. We enrolled 31 patients who were diagnosed as mesalamine intolerance between April 2015 to March 2020. We examined clinical features, time to onset, drug types of mesalamine, DLST positive rate, colonoscopy findings, disease activity, and clinical course after diagnosis. The average dose of mesalamine was 3.69 g and DLST-positive was 57.1%. Within the first 2 weeks from the start of mesalamine, 51.6% showed symptoms of intolerance. The serum CRP level was relatively high at ≥10.0 mg/dl in 53.6% of the cases. There was no difference in clinical background, symptoms, or laboratory findings between patients with DLST-positive and negative. In this study, we clarified the clinical characteristics of mesalamine intolerant patients, and found no difference in the clinical background or success rate of desensitization therapy between positive and negative DLST cases.

Background/Aims: Several studies have assessed the effect of cool temperature on colonic peristalsis. Transient receptor potential melastatin 8 (TRPM8) is a temperature-sensitive ion channel activated by mild cooling expressed in the colon. We examined the antispasmodic effect of cool temperature on colonic peristalsis in a prospective, randomized, single-blind trial and based on the video imaging and intraluminal pressure of the proximal colon in rats and TRPM8-deficient mice. Methods: In the clinical trial, we randomly assigned a total of 94 patients scheduled to undergo colonoscopy to 2 groups: the mildly cool water (n = 47) and control (n = 47) groups. We used 20 mL of 15°C water for the mildly cool water. The primary outcome was the proportion of subjects with improved peristalsis after treatment. In the rodent proximal colon, we evaluated the intraluminal pressure and performed video imaging of the rodent proximal colon with cool water administration into the colonic lumen. Clinical trial registry website (Trial No. UMIN-CTR; UMIN000030725). Results: In the randomized controlled trial, after treatment, the proportion of subjects with no peristalsis with cool water was significantly higher than that in the placebo group (44.7% vs 23.4%; P < 0.05). In the rodent colon model, cool temperature water was associated with a significant decrease in colonic peristalsis through its suppression of the ratio of peak frequency (P < 0.05). Cool temperature-treated TRPM8-deficient mice did not show a reduction in colonic peristalsis compared with wild-type mice. Conclusion: For the first time, this study demonstrates that cool temperature-dependent suppression of colonic peristalsis may be associated with TRPM8 activation.

A male in his sixties with locally advanced pancreatic ductal adenocarcinoma (PDAC) was administered gemcitabine plus nab-paclitaxel therapy. Computed tomography (CT) scans after five courses revealed nonspecific interstitial pneumonitis in addition to PDAC aggravation. No evidence of respiratory infection was detected, and his condition was stable and asymptomatic at diagnosis. Sputum test and interferon-gamma release assay revealed no evidence of tuberculosis. Through careful history taking, the patient was found to be taking dietary supplementation with Agaricus blazei Murill extract for approximately 1 month. Drug-induced lymphocyte stimulation tests for gemcitabine and nab-paclitaxel were negative, whereas those for Agaricus blazei Murill were positive. CT scans after withdrawal showed improved pneumonitis. These findings suggest a possibility that the dietary supplementation may lead to drug-induced interstitial lung disease (ILD). This patient indicates that pertinent diagnostic interviews are essential for the identification of drug-induced ILD.

BACKGROUND: Recent progress in ulcerative colitis (UC) treatment has been remarkable, and various medications have been applied. However, some patients with UC are refractory to treatment and convert to surgery. AIM: To investigate the role of colonic mucosal Wnt-5a expression in the pathogenesis of UC and the effect of bioactive Wnt-5a peptide on colitis in mice. METHODS: Wnt-5a peptide was intraperitoneally administered to mice every day from the beginning of dextran sulfate sodium (DSS) treatment. The severity of colitis was evaluated based on body weight change, colonic length, and histological scores. Colonic mucosal TNF-α and KC mRNA expression levels were measured. This study included 70 patients with UC in clinical remission. Wnt-5a, TNFα, and IL-8 mRNA expression in the rectal mucosa were measured by quantitative real-time polymerase chain reaction using biopsy materials. Wnt-5a mRNA expression levels were compared between patients who relapsed and those in remission. We examined the correlation of Wnt-5a expression with TNF-α and IL-8 expression. RESULTS: Wnt-5a peptide significantly attenuated the severity of DSS-induced colitis. Moreover, mucosal TNF-α and KC mRNA expression were significantly suppressed by Wnt-5a peptide treatment. Wnt-5a mRNA levels were significantly lower in patients with subsequent relapse than in those who remained in remission. Mucosal Wnt-5a was inversely correlated with TNF α and IL-8 expression. CONCLUSION: Wnt-5a peptide suppressed colitis in mice, and decreased Wnt-5a expression was strongly associated with relapse in patients with UC. Wnt-5a may have an inhibitory effect on mucosal inflammation in UC, and Wnt-5a peptide could be a new therapeutic strategy.

OBJECTIVES: Endoscopic ultrasound-guided tissue acquisition (EUS-TA) plays a crucial role in the diagnosis of pancreatic tumors. The present study aimed to investigate the current status of needle tract seeding (NTS) after EUS-TA of pancreatic tumors based on a nationwide survey in Japan. METHODS: Patients who underwent surgical resection of primary pancreatic tumors after EUS-TA performed between April 2010 and March 2018 were surveyed. The incidence rates of NTS were determined, and compared in patients with pancreatic ductal adenocarcinomas (PDACs) and other tumors, and in patients who underwent transgastric and transduodenal EUS-TA of PDACs. The detailed features and prognosis of patients with NTS were also assessed. RESULTS: A total of 12,109 patients underwent surgical resection of primary pancreatic tumors after EUS-TA. The overall incidence rate of NTS was 0.330%, and the NTS rate was significantly higher in patients with PDAC than in those with other tumors (0.409% vs. 0.071%, P=0.004). NTS was observed in 0.857% of patients who underwent transgastric EUS-TA, but in none of those who underwent transduodenal EUS-TA. Of the patients with NTS of PDACs, the median time from EUS-TA to occurrence of NTS and median patient survival were 19.3 and 44.7 months, respectively, with 97.4% of NTS located in the gastric wall and 65.8% of NTS resected. The patient survival was significantly longer in patients who underwent NTS resection than in those without NTS resection (P=0.037). CONCLUSIONS: NTS appeared only after transgastric not after transduodenal EUS-TA. Careful follow-up provides an opportunity to remove localized NTS lesions by gastrectomy.

Background: A compact and cost-effective light source-processor combined 3-color light-emitting diode (LED) endoscopic system (ELUXEO-Lite: EP-6000, Fujifilm Co., Tokyo) with a magnified colonoscope (EC-6600ZP, Fujifilm Co.) has been released. Aims: In this study, we analyzed the efficacy of this system for colorectal tumor characterization with magnified blue light imaging (BLI-LED) and image's subjective and objective evaluations, compared to a magnified blue laser imaging (BLI-LASER) using a standard LASER endoscopic system. Methods: We retrospectively reviewed 37 lesions observed with both BLI-LED and BLI-LASER systems from 2019 using the Japanese narrow band imaging classification. Two representative magnified images, one BLI-LED and one BLI-LASER, of the same area of a lesion were evaluated for diagnostic accuracy and visualization quality by three experts and three non-experts. Their color difference values (CDVs) and brightness values (BVs) were also calculated as objective indicators. Results: Among 37 lesions, mean tumor size was 18.9 ± 13.1 mm, and 21 lesions were nonpolypoid. Histopathology revealed 14 sessile serrated lesions, 7 adenomas, 12 high-grade dysplasias and T1a cancers, and 4 T1b cancers. The diagnostic accuracy rates of BLI-LED/BLI-LASER of experts and non-experts were 90.1% and 87.4% (p = 0.52) and 89.2% and 89.2% (p = 0.99). The percentages of instances where BLI-LED images were better, the two imaging types were equivalent, or BLI-LASER images were better were 16%/83%/1% for experts and 19%/58%/23% for non-experts (p < 0.001). CDVs and BVs between BLI-LED and BLI-LASER were not significantly different (CDVs: p = 0.653, BVs: p = 0.518). Conclusions: BLI-LED using the compact system was noninferior to BLI-LASER for colorectal tumor characterization and image quality.

BACKGROUND AND AIM: Complete endoscopic mucosal healing is defined as a Mayo endoscopic subscore of 0. Some patients diagnosed with a Mayo endoscopic subscore 0 may present with subsequent clinical relapse. Here, we aimed to demonstrate mucosal cytokine profile as a predictor of clinical relapse in ulcerative colitis patients with a Mayo endoscopic subscore of 0 as a marker of mucosal healing. METHODS: We conducted prospective observational pilot study to examine the relationship between mucosal cytokine expression and subsequent relapse of UC patients diagnosed with a Mayo endoscopic subscore of 0. We enrolled 55 patients, and expression of cytokines tumor necrosis factor-α, interferon γ, interleukin-1ß, interleukin-2, interleukin-4, interleukin-5, interleukin-6, interleukin-7, interleukin-8, interleukin-9, interleukin-10, interleukin-12, interleukin-13, interleukin-15, interleukin-17A, interleukin-17F, interleukin-18, interleukin-21, interleukin-22, interleukin-23, interleukin-27, and interleukin-33 was measured by quantitative real-time PCR using rectal mucosa biopsy materials. Cytokine expression levels were compared between patients who relapsed between March 1, 2016, and March 30, 2020, of the study period and those who remained in remission. RESULTS: Ten cytokines, including interleukin-2, interleukin-4, interleukin-8, interleukin-10, interleukin-12, interleukin-15, interleukin-17A, interleukin-21, interleukin-23, and interleukin-33, were significantly elevated in patients with subsequent relapse compared with those who remained in remission. Interleukin-8 expression was the most useful predictor. CONCLUSIONS: In the rectal mucosa of ulcerative colitis patients with Mayo endoscopic subscore 0, levels of several cytokines were elevated in cases of subsequent relapse. Among these, interleukin-8 expression was the most useful for predicting relapse.
